The result was mixed for Argentina at the Australian Open, as Juan Martín del Potro advanced further in the competition, while David Nalbandian fell under controversy and subsequently left the tournament in Melbourne.
The player from Tandil confidently beat Slovene Blaz Kavcic, in a total of three sets (6-4, 7-5, 6-3), in Melbourne, moving him forward in the Australian Open.
Del Potro, who has plummeted to 11th place ATP ranking had recently resigned to play the first round of the Davis Cup next Feb 10 to 12 against Germany
In the next instance, Juan Martín Del Potro will face Yeng Hsung, from Taiwan.
Meanwhile a furious David Nalbandian was eliminated after his game against American John Isner 4-6, 6-3, 4-6, 7-6 (7-5 el tie break) y 10-8, in the second round of the Australian Open today
